Utilities for matching unformatted addresses with PAF UDPRN.
These utilities require sample data available from the UK Royal Mail at https://www.poweredbypaf.com/using-our-address-data/use-the-data-yourself/; the addressloader will load this data into a local MongoDB as specified in the addressutils.cfg file.

Address data is loaded into the DB via addressload.py, addressmatch.py allows you to match candidate addresses on the command line against the DB, the unit tests are found in testaddressutils.py.
